Halesowen Town produced one of the most extraordinary returns of all time to defeat Nuneaton Borough 9-8 in the second qualifying round of the FA Youth Cup.
West Midlands was being defeated 7-2 by Nuneaton Borough in 60 minutes, but then seized an amazing victory, writes Periscope.
As they were being defeated 8-7, Emlyn Tudgay scored twice in the extra time to achieve victory.
